Abstract
On endometriosis, macrophage and TNF -α was found in higher concentration. Tumor Necrosis
Factor-α activates NF-κB pathway and increase the expression of MMP-9’s gen. NF-κB pathway can
be blocked by Hylocereus polyrhizus peel.
The objective of this study was to know the effect of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ract
at dose 0,25; 0,5 mg/gram BW/day; and 1 mg/gram on TNF-α concentration, number of macrophage,
and MMP-9 expression on mouse model of endometriosis.
This study was a laboratory experimental research. Thirty female mice were used as samples and
divided into 5 groups: 1 positive control, 1 negative control, and 3 treatment groups. Positive control
and treatment groups were induced as model of endometrios is for 14 days. The next 14 days, Na -
CMC 0,5% was given to both control groups, while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ract dose
0,25; 0,5 mg/gram BW/day; and 1 mg/gram were given to treatment groups orally. Peritoneum fluid
and endometriosis lesion were examined.
There were significantly differences on TNF -α concentration (p=0.021), number of macrophage
(p=0.00), and MMP -9 expression (p=0.002) among control groups and treatment groups. TNF -α
concentrations were higher on treatment groups.
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ract can be used as alternative therapy for attenuating the
alteration of macrophage and MMP-9 in endometriosis disease.

Introduction
Endometriosis is defined as the presence
of endometriosis -like tissue outside the uterus,
which induces a chronic inflammatory reaction. 1
The prevalence of endometriosis in the population
is difficult to determine but estimates between 2 to
10% within the female population while 50% in
infertile women. Most women with endometriosis
experience painful symptoms thus infertility. 2
Management of endometriosis can be divided into
empirical treatments and surgery. However, the
recurrence rate after treatment is
higher, about 35% in mild endometriosis and 74%
in severe endometriosis. 3 The high recurrence
rate due to endometriosis is a progressive disease
and needed long-time treatment.4
Materials and methods
This study has been received approval
ethical clea rance letter of animal subjects from
Faculty of Veterinary Medicine Universitas
Airlangga with number 710 -KE. This study was a
laboratory experimental research. Thirty female
mice (Mus musculus), aged 2-3 months, weighing
20-25 gram, were used as samples.

After adaptation for a week, female mice then
divided into 5 groups, which are: positive
control group (K1), negative control group (K2),
treatment group with Hylocereus polyrhizus peel
ethanol extract dose 0,25 mg/gram BW/day (K3),
treatment group with Hylocereus polyrhizus peel
ethanol extract dose 0,5 mg/gram BW/day (K4),
and treatment group with Hylocereus polyrhizus
peel ethanol extract dose 1 mg/gram/day (K5).
Positive contro l and treatment groups were
induced as model of endometriosis by this
following steps: 1) injection of cyclosporin A (0,2
ml/mice) intramuscular on day one to make mice
in immunodefficiency state. Cyclosporin A was
purchased from Sandimmun (North Ryde,
Australia); 2) injection of ethinyl estradiol 20.000
IU (0,1 ml/mice) on day one and five; 3) injection
of implant tissue (0,1 ml/mice) in the peritoneal
cavity on day one. Implant tissue is derived from
the myometrium and endometrium of gynecologic
benign t umor patient who underwent surgery
procedure and didn’t use hormonal contraception
at least for last 3 months before surgery. The
animal model was observed for 14 days to be the
mice model of endometriosis.
Starting from 15 th day, Na -CMC 0,5%
(Clorogreen Gemilang™, Bandung, Indonesia)
was given to both control groups as placebo.
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ract dose
0,25 mg/gram BW/day was given to group K3,
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ract dose
0,5 mg/gram BW/day was given to group K4, and
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ract dose 1
mg/gram/day was given to group K5. These
placebo and extract was administered orally (0,2
ml/25 mg/gram BW/day) for 14 days with an oral
gavage.
At the end of experiment, mice were
anesthetized with ketamin (Ketamin Hydrochloride
Pfizer®, New Jersey, USA) and acepromazine
(Castran®,Venray, Holland). Peritoneal fluid
samples were obtained by peritoneum puncture to
examine TNF -α concentration using Enzyme
Linked Immunosorbent Assay kit (Elabscience™,
Wuhan, China), then endometriosis lesions in
peritoneum cavity were collected. Formalin -fixed,
paraffin-embedded tissue sections from
endometriosis lesion were tested by
immunohistochemistry to see MMP-9 expressions
(Bioss Antibody Incorporation™, Massachu ssets,
USA). The other tissue sections from
endometriosis lesion were tested by Hematoxillin
Eosin (HE) staining (DAKO™, California,USA) to
count macrophages on the lesions. The number of
macrophages from 5 field -view then categorized
by Klopfleisch scoring system. This score criterias
are: 0 if there was no macrophage infiltration, 1 if
there were less than 10 macrophage infiltration, 2
if there were 11 -50 macrophage infiltration, 3 if
there were 51-100 macrophage infiltration, and 4 if
there were more th an 100 macrophage
infiltration.13
Matrix Metalloproteinase -9 expressions
were analyzed using modified Remmele and
Stegnes semiquantitative scoring system (1986).
This Immuno Reactive Score (IRS) is a result from
multiplication between immunoreactive cells
procentage (A) and colour intensity score on
immunoreactive cells (B). Datas were collected
from 5 field-view. The immunoreactive cells score
citerias (A) are: 0 if there was no positive cell, 1 if
procentage of positive cells was less than 10%, 2
if proc entage of positive cells was 11 -50%, 3 if
procentage of positive cells was 51 -80%, and 4 if
procentage of positive cells was more than 80%.
While colour intensity score (B) criterias are: 0 if
there was no colour reaction, 1 if the intensity of
colour is low, 2 if the intensity of colour is average,
and 3 if the intensity of colour is high.14
Shapiro Wilk test was used to know the
normality of data and Levene test was used to
know the homogenity of data. If distribution and
homogenity of data were normal (p>0.05), One
Way Anova test was conducted, followed with
posthoc Bonferroni, but, if the data distribution or
homogenity wasn’t normal, Kruskall -Wallis test
followed with Mann Whitney test, were conducted.
Analysis was performed with IBM SPSS
Statistics versions 24.00 (New York, USA).

Results
Result showed that there were mean
differences among K1, K2, K3, K4, and K5 groups,
as seen on table 1.
Table 1. TNF-α Concentration on Mice Model
Endometriosis AmongzControl Groups and
Treatment Groups.
The level of TNF -α concentration was
higher in the endometriosis model groups (K2, K3,
K4, and K5) compared to the negative control
group (K1). All doses of Hylocereus polyrhizus
peel ethanol extract also have higher level of TNF-
α concentration compared to K1.
Statistical analysis was conducted by One
Way Anova test with p=0.021, that means there
was significantly differences among groups.
Posthoc Bonferroni test showed that there were
significantly differences between K1 and K4.
Result
showed that there were mean
differences among K1, K2, K3, K4, and K5 groups,
as seen on table 2. The numbers of macrophage
were decreased on treatment groups. This
reduction was linear with the increasing of
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ract doses.
Statistical analysis was conducted by Kruskall
Wallis test with p=0.000, that means there was at
least 1 significantly differences between 2 groups.
Mann Whitney test showed that there were
significantly differences between: K1 and K2, K1
and K3, K1 and K4, K2 and K3, K2 and K4, K2 and
K5, and K3 and K5.

Result
showed th at there were mean
differences among K1, K2, K3, K4, and K5 groups,
as seen on table 3, figure 1, 2.
The MMP -9 expressions were decreased
on treatment groups. This reduction was linear
with the increasing of Hylocereus polyrhizus peel
ethanol extract’s d oses. Statistical analysis was
conducted by Kruskall Wallis test with p=0.002,
that means there was at least 1 significantly
differences between 2 groups. Mann Whitney test
showed that there were significantly differences
between: K1 and K2, K1 and K3, K2 and K3, K2
and K4, K2 and K5, and K3 and K4.
Discussion
The result of this study showed that
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ract was
able to reduce the number of macrophage and
MMP-9 expression on mice model endometriosis.
But, the extract wasn’t able to reduce TNF -α
concentration.10 Hylocereus polyrhizus peel
ethanol extract which contain betalain, were given
to mice model endometriosis to inhibit NFκB
pathway, which is activated by macrophage and
endometriosis cells when t hese cells bind to their
receptors.15,16
By blocking NF -κB pathway, it was
supposed that the genes expression of TNF -α,
MMP-9, and MCP -1 reduced. This study result
presented that the secretion of TNF -α by
macrophage wasn’t reduced. This may because
the production of TNF-α by macrophage isn’t only
through NF -κB pathway 16,17. There is possibility
that TNF -α can be produced through MAPK
(mitogen-activated protein kinase) pathway. 19,20
So that, although the extract inhibited NF -κB
pathway, the production of TN Fα was still high
through MAPK pathway.
This study also presented that MMP-9 and
number of macrophage were significantly greater
in the positive control group compared to other
groups. These increased levels of MMP -9 in mice
model endometriosis were significantly reduced by
0,5 mg/gram BW/day and 1 mg/gram
administration of Hylocereus polyrhizus peel
ethanol extract to those comparable to the
negative control group. Administration of
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ract dose 1
mg/gram also can red uce the number of
macrophage to those comparable to the negative
control group.
Conclusions
The conclusion of this study
was Hylocereus polyrhizus peel ethanol extract
can be used as alternative therapy for attenuating
the alteration of macrophage and
MMP-9 in endometriosis disease.
